Solution Overview

Problem

The manual configuration of camera profiles in video camera systems is a cumbersome process, requiring significant time and effort, especially in large security systems with hundreds of cameras.

Innovation Solution

A method and apparatus that utilize video analytics scene classification, including AI and ML models, to automatically configure camera profiles by classifying scenes and selecting appropriate profiles based on metadata, thereby automating the rule creation process and reducing installation time and costs.

Solution Approach 2:

The system utilizes parameter changes by dynamically adjusting camera configuration parameters based on detected scene characteristics. Different scene types (e.g., indoor, outdoor, night, day) trigger different profile parameters such as exposure, gain, and white balance settings, allowing the camera to adapt its parameters automatically to match the current environment.

AI summary

Example implementations include a method, apparatus and computer-readable medium for configuring profiles for a camera, comprising receiving video from the camera. The implementations further include classifying a first scene of the first video stream. Additionally, the implementations further include determining a first metadata for the first scene. Additionally, the implementations further include selecting a first profile for the camera based on the first metadata, wherein the first profile comprises one or more configuration parameters, wherein values of each of the one or more configuration parameters of the first profile are based on the first metadata. Additionally, the implementations further include configuring the camera with the first profile.
